Chapter 3. Initial Setup and Programming

3.1 Introduction

This chapter provides instructions for programming the PanaFlow HT flowmeter to place it into operation. Before the
PanaFlow HT can begin taking measurements, the User Preferences, Inputs/Outputs, and SIL testing must be entered
and tested.

3.2 User Restrictions

If a Dangerous Detected state occurs, the flowmeter will put the SIL Output in the DD state and remain that way until
an Authorized User intervenes. The DD state can be cleared by executing a reset of the flowmeter. There are two
methods for clearing the DD state:
1. Enter the Program menu at SIL user access level. Then exit without making any changes. The flowmeter will
execute a soft reset.
2. Turn off power, wait 1 minute, turn power back on.
